I am attempting to read a single data value from Excel (Column heading Ready_ Status) with DRS_connector stage

Connection string
Driver={Microsoft Excel Driver (*.xls, *.xlsx, *.xlsm, *.xlsb)};DriverId=790;Dbq=F:\Data\EDW_DEV\Import\ETL_DATA.xls.ETL_Data;DefaultDir=F:\Data\EDW_DEV\Import;READONLY=TRUE;FirstRowHasNames=1

SQL Statement
SELECT Ready_Status FROM F:\Data\EDW_DEV\Import\ETL_DATA.xls

Test job design is DRS_Connector - Transform - Peek

The Errors I get

tfrMap: Error when checking operator: Could not find input field "Ready_Status".

DRS_Connector_3: When checking operator: The modify operator has a binding for the non-existent output field "Ready_Status".

Any advice on what I need to do to solve this problem

I read somewhere and aware that i need to use ODBC to read .xls in Datastage, but today is the first time i connected the .xls file using Datastage.

Steps:

In Windows ODBC
1. Create a SYSTEM DSN (Not User DSN - Thanks Ray. I saw your comment)
1a. Choose the proper Excel Version
1b. Select the work book (using Browse)


Now come to Datastage:

Notes: I used ODBC Connector Stage
2. Use the ODBC Connector Stage
3. Pass the DSN name (Eg: TEST_XLS)
3a. No need to pass username and password
4. Generated SQL = No
5. Import the metadata using ODBC & use that metadata.
5a. Remember the metadata name. In my case TEST$
6. In the select statement pass select * from `TEST$`
6a: Note: This is not ' it is `
7. Just run the job.

I can't view the data, but when i run the job i can see the data in the output.

Hope this will help of someone is trying to connect .xsl file using Datastage.
